Daehan Shipbuilding files Chapter 15 case, cites Korean rehabilitation

By Caroline Salls

Pittsburgh, Aug. 19 – Daehan Shipbuilding Co., Ltd. made a Chapter 15 bankruptcy filing on Monday in the U.S. Bankruptcy Court for the Southern District of New York to gain U.S. recognition of its rehabilitation proceeding under the Republic of Korea’s Debtor Rehabilitation and Bankruptcy Act.

In a statement filed with the court, custodian and foreign representative Byung Mo Lee said the company recently suffered from a “serious liquidity crisis due to the economic recession arising from the global financial crisis in 2008.”

Lee said these issues were compounded by the financial difficulties of Daehan’s parent company, Dae Ju Construction Industry Co., Ltd., during the same timeframe.

As a result, the company’s credit rating plummeted, resulting in the cancellation of 22 of its ship building contracts.

In addition, Lee said Doehan suffered major losses stemming from currency fluctuations following the economic recession, which were made worse by the inflation in the personnel expenses and distribution costs for ship building.

On March 3, Rimpacific Navigation Inc. and Wonder Enterprises Ltd. filed a petition for recognition of foreign judgments against the company in the Supreme Court of the State of New York, County of New York, seeking recognition and enforcement of a $54.54 million English judgment rendered in favor of Rimpacific and Wonder.

Daehan is asking the court to stay the filing or continuation of all actions against the company as part of the Chapter 15 filing.

According to court documents, Daehan has $100 million to $500 million in assets and $500 million to $1 billion in debt.

The company is represented by Blank Rome LLP.

Daehan is a Hwawon-myeon, Haenam-gun Jeollanam-do, South Korea ship building company. The Chapter 15 case number is 14-12391.
